    Job Description

    General Summary:
    Through internal audits the Internal Audit Manager will identify risk areas, evaluate business process controls and complete test plans. Additionally, this role will provide recommendations to improve the effectiveness and efficiency of operations and business systems.

    This role will also participate in ensuring that the yearly internal control review is brought to fruition by interacting with SOX testers, other stakeholders, and subject matter experts on special projects and the development and execution of departmental goals.

    This position is based in our Boston, MA office, located in the Seaport area.

    This role requires a hybrid work schedule: 3 days in office & 2 days remote on a weekly basis.

    Key Duties and Responsibilities:
    Plans and performs financial, operational and, as applicable, IT audits; reviews related records for compliance with established and relevant reporting policies and procedures

    Applies financial and quantitative analyses and risk assessment procedures, documents findings/work papers in support of departmental goals and objectives

    Maintains and applies an understanding of generally accepted accounting principles/standards and/or general IT frameworks

    Identifies and effectively communicates (both verbally and/or in writing) audit results, control weaknesses,

    accounting/reporting/application

    deficiencies, process or company risk, business productivity and efficiency opportunities, departmental vision, and any other relevant matters to management or other applicable parties

    Reviews, appraises and tests the internal controls surrounding business processes to assess compliance with the Sarbanes-Oxley Act

    Collaborates constructively and respectfully with fellow audit team members and business stakeholders including with multicultural teams and in global locations

    Maintains communication with the Engagement Manager, responds to feedback and adjusts approach as the situation warrants

    Contributes in management meetings, presents findings, conclusions and recommended actions to business management


    Knowledge and Skills:
    Experience within Life Sciences or related sector

    Excellent organizational and project management skills

    Excellent written and verbal communication skills

    Detail oriented, able to multitask and meet deadlines

    Able to work under general supervision and work collaboratively with diverse teams

    Expanded knowledge of audit methodology, risk assessment and internal control concepts

    Ability to analyze process workflows and identify gaps and bottleneck

    Ability to perform data analytics, SOC1 reviews and understand ITGCs

    Obtain and provide training to the audit staff to support all aspects of Internal Audit activities to ensure that approved audit objectives are met

    Ability to operate effectively independently and in a team-oriented, multiple location environment

    CPA, CIA or CISA certifications or equivalent a plus


    Education and Experience:
    Bachelor's degree in

    accounting/finance/information

    systems or related field

    Typically requires 5+ years of auditing experience or the equivalent combination of education and experience

    Vertex is a global biotechnology company that invests in scientific innovation to create transformative medicines for people with serious diseases.

    The company has approved medicines that treat the underlying causes of multiple chronic, life-shortening genetic diseases — cystic fibrosis, sickle cell disease and

    transfusion-dependent

    beta thalassemia — and continues to advance clinical and research programs in these diseases. Vertex also has a robust clinical pipeline of investigational therapies across a range of modalities in other serious diseases where it has deep insight into causal human biology, including APOL1-mediated kidney disease, acute and neuropathic pain, type 1 diabetes, myotonic dystrophy type 1 and alpha-1 antitrypsin deficiency

    .

    Founded in 1989 in Cambridge, Mass., Vertex's global headquarters is now located in Boston's Innovation District and its international headquarters is in London.

    Additionally, the company has research and development sites and commercial offices in North America, Europe, Australia, Latin America and the Middle East.

    Vertex is consistently recognized as one of the industry's top places to work, including 14 consecutive years on Science magazine's Top Employers list and one of Fortune's 100 Best Companies to Work For.
